This plus-size one-piece combines functional shaping with decorative touches that feel considered rather than costume-y. The ruched side panels create visual interest and allow the fabric to drape in a way that adapts to different body shapes, while the lace trim at the neckline adds a subtle feminine detail that doesn't read as overly fussy poolside.
It's built for women who swim, lounge, and move between activities without constantly adjusting. The V-neck sits at a depth that flatters without requiring constant vigilance, and the silhouette offers enough coverage to feel secure during actual swimming or active play, not just sunbathing. CUPSHE's plus sizing tends to run true, though the ruching does most of its work through the torso, so those looking for significant control might layer with separate shapewear.
The tradeoff is durability in chlorinated or saltwater settings. Like most fashion swimwear with decorative elements, the lace and ruching benefit from hand washing and will show wear faster than plain athletic styles. It earns its spot in a rotation for vacation pools, resort wear, and occasions where you want one flattering suit that transitions from water to lunch without a full wardrobe change.
